Tulsa International Airport (TUL)
- General
- Type: Airport, Status: Operational, Acivation Date: 08/01/1942, Runways: 3, Land Area Covered By Airport: 4360 acres, Ownership: Publicly owned, Facility Use: Open to public, Site Number: 19283.*A, Location ID: TUL, Region: Southwest, District Office: AOK, Unicom Frequency: 122.950 MHz, Aeronautical sectional chart: Kansas City, Tie-In FSS: No, Tie-In FSS ID: MLC, Tie-In FSS Name: Mc Alester, Tie-In FSS Toll-Free Number: 1-800-WX-BRIEF, Elevation: 677 ft, Elevation determination method: Surveyed, Elevation Source: 3RD PARTY SURVEY (2011-06-1), Air traffic control tower: Yes, Boundary ARTCC (FAA) computer ID: ZCK, Boundary ARTCC ID: ZKC, Boundary ARTCC Name: Kansas City, Airspace Determination: Not Analyzed, Certification Type & Date: I C S 05/1973, Federal Agreements: NGPRSY3, NOTAM Service: Yes, NOTAM Facility ID: TUL, Last Inspection Date: 09/09/2015, Inspection Group: FAA airports field personnel, Inspection Method: Federal
- Location
- State: Oklahoma, County: Tulsa, City: Tulsa, GPS (Degrees): Lat: 36° 11' 54.200'', Lng: -95° 53' 17.200'', GPS (Seconds): Lat: 36.198389, Lng: -95.888111, GPS determination method: Estimated, Position Source: 3RD PARTY SURVEY (2011-06-1), Distance from central business district: 5 mi (NE) Find on map
- Owner
- City Of Tulsa, Tulsa Arpt Auth. Box 581838, Tulsa, Ok 74158, 918-838-5000
- Manager
- Jeff Mulder, Po Box 581838, Tulsa, Ok 74158, 918-838-5000
- Operations
- Period: 12/31/2014 - 12/31/2015, Commercial Operations: 27,772, Air Taxi Operations: 23,767, Itinerant Operations: 23,721, Local Operations: 2,913, Military Operations: 16,817
- Aircraft
- Single Engine Aircraft: 58, Multi Engine Aircraft: 33, Jet Engine Aircraft: 73, Helicopters: 1, Military Aircraft Operational (Including Helicopters): 22
- Additional
- Fuel Types: 100LLA A1 B, Magnetic Variation: 3E (Year 2020), Beacon Color: Clear-green (lighted land airport), Bottled Oxygen Type: High/Low pressure, Bulk Oxygen Type: High/Low pressure, Lighting Schedule: Ss-Sr, Beacon Schedule: Ss-Sr, Airframe repair service availability/type: Major, Power Plant repair service availability/type: Major, Customs Airport Of Entry: No, Customs Landing Rights: Yes, Military/civil joint use agreement: Yes, Military Landing Rights: Yes, Non-Commercial Landing Fee: No, Transient storage: HGR,TIE, Wind direction indicator: Y-L, Segmented circle airport marker system: No, Other services: AFRT, AMB, AVNCS, CARGO, CHTR, INSTR, RNTL, SALES
